These cables are designed to be used in installations where smoke and acid gas emission would pose a major hazard in the event of a fire. Ordinary duty flexible cords are used where the risk of mechanical damage and mechanical stresses is normal, i.e. when cables are subject to low mechanical stresses in the areas of application, and the risk of mechanical damage is low, as is the case to be expected in the normal use of small to medium size equipment in domestic and commercial as well as in light industrial premises. Examples of appliances that use ordinary duty flexible cords include vacuum cleaners, toasters, washing machines, refrigerators, dryers and televisions.
